Output 41686abdc70fceac1d793e3d0d8b6bde2e77e47006019ee479b21a2bb728be96:50

value
6589612
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cf986ec2b56997c18296540677eaeece5ccebcf OP_EQUAL
address
MEvAWTB12MWTxxyKrr98f27VJScinm3uYm
transaction
41686abdc70fceac1d793e3d0d8b6bde2e77e47006019ee479b21a2bb728be96
spent
true